Output 57abaa1623081f6481f5c7129966a8ae442bb84822e2bb61f168f2f67f98eeda:0

value
51216868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f51be5c4780792b744646ea2a2343081439a6e17 OP_EQUAL
address
MWFBCnN5rdWmFGf54HZpY1rz19EaHJxt1A
transaction
57abaa1623081f6481f5c7129966a8ae442bb84822e2bb61f168f2f67f98eeda
spent
true